Column: Abramoff defrauded Saginaw Chippewa Tribe
Friday, July 1, 2005

"Are there really people on the Saginaw Chippewa Indian Reservation who support Jack Abramoff and Michael Scanlon? Are there really people out there who think that the Tribe got its money's worth of lobbying and influence in Washington?

There is enough in the public record that there is no need to wait for a guilty verdict to pass judgement - these guys, Abramoff and Scanlon, are pond scum.

No, pond scum has redeeming ecological value. Abramoff and Scanlon are lower than pond scum, parasites with no redeeming qualities. They're vile, and when the deal finally goes down in Washington, they'll probably try to sell out their long-dead ancestors to avoid spending time in prison. There are already rumblings that they're getting read to sell-out anyone. Former friends, allies, and co-workers - word is that Abramoff and Scanlon won't spare any of them if it'll help save their corrupt skins."
